Transaction b8d81bf1c6f1f146b25e0f9eaf47716a18c6e73fc245e342202a4bd929450194

141 Input
1 Outputs
  • b8d81bf1c6f1f146b25e0f9eaf47716a18c6e73fc245e342202a4bd929450194:0
  • value  547959952
    address  34wfTfmEPfdjzHoVBvsA9XiCjDAwmJY11R